Hi,

I have a Portuguese client, married to her Portuguese husband with three children, two of whom live in Portugal with relatives. Both have been in the UK for several years and both were working before ill health forced him out of work and onto Incapacity Benefit. She then gave up work to claim CA for looking after him.

She wants to claim Child Benefit for the two children in Portugal but has apparently been turned down. I am waiting to see her later this week and hope to see some paperwork to that effect.

However, I have A8 Nationals who can claim CHB for kids in their birth country, provided they are on the Workers Registration Scheme and comply with the other criteria, so i believe my Portuguese client may be able to as well. Does the fact that they are both not working have an impact on their right to CHB?

Thanks Mick. I'd read through that and taken advice from a consultancy line but still don't have an exact answer. Further enquiries to the CHB office have resulted in me being told that only workers or those in receipt of Contribution based benefits can get the CHB. My client is on I.S due to incapacity so credits only. I've been told this means he wont qualify as he needs to have paid into the system to get the CHB for the daughters in Portugal.

I'm still looking into this tho, I wonder what would happen if one of the girls moved to the UK, would he then still not be entitled?
